Honda Factory CD player fitment ???'s
Will a factory CD player from a '00 Civic Si (for example, or any other factory Honda cd player) fit into a crx dash with no mods, just straight drop in? Looking for a player for my nephews '91 Crx Si.

I know for a fact that the 2000 Integra GSR CD player fits in perfectly and the harness even matches without conversion. IT's a perfect plug and play.
The 94-01 integras could all use the same CD player, but I'm not sure.

It will fit in of course, but you will need to get a conversion harness. You should be able to pick it up at any stereo place.
The only reason I know this is I have the 00 Si (SiR in Canada) deck in my 91 Hatch. I don’t know ANYTHING about stereos, and a friend put it in for me. He just picked up the wire harness at a stereo place for 5 bucks or something, no biggie. You can hard wire it if you want to, but that’s a bit of a pain in the ***. Sorry I don’t remember what the harness number or model is, but like I said, any stereo place should have it if you bring in the deck and show them the back.
I like it just because it says Honda on it and is a fairly good deck and keeps the stock look.

Yah i got a civic and an integra. THey will not plug and play. The Integra CD player will fit perfect in the crx and will not need any harness. The civic cd player however, will need a harness that plugs in the car's factory harness and goes to the cd player.
